1 - Torque converter housing; 1a, 2a, Zb, 19a-Bolts; 2 - Transmission housing; 3 - Pallet; Pros - Spacer; 5 - Oil filter; 12a - Teflon rings; 18, 67a - Gaskets; 19 - Electrohydraulic control unit AT; 20 - Radial oil seal; 21 - Guide bushing; 21a - Sealing rings; 47 - Nut; 48 - Output flange; 67 - Ball bearing; 68 - Retaining ring
Disassembly
1. Loosen guide sleeve 21 and remove it from the transmission.
2. Remove the tray 3.
3. Remove the oil filter 5.
4. Unscrew bolts 19a and remove the electro-hydraulic control unit AT 19.
5. Remove flange 48.
6. Press out radial oil seal 20, remove gaskets 67a, retaining ring 68 and press out ball bearing 67 from the transmission housing.
7. Remove gasket 18.
8. Unscrew bolt 1a and 2a from the torque converter and transmission housing.
9. Remove transmission housing 2 from torque converter housing 1.
Assembly
1. Lubricate with sealant and insert all 12a Teflon rings into the groove together
2. Install gearbox 2 on torque converter 1. Align brake discs B2 and B3.
3. Tighten bolts 1a and 2a.
4. Measure the clearance between the parking brake pawl and the ball bearing. It should be within 0.3-0.5 mm.
5. Install gasket 18, press the ball bearing into the rear part of the transmission housing.
6. Install gaskets 67a.
7. Install radial oil seal 20 into the transmission housing.
8. Install flange 48.
9. Install and tighten the AT 19 electrohydraulic control unit mounting bolts.
10. Further assembly is carried out in the reverse order of disassembly.
